Bioprocessing Biomass for Fuel
Credit: 4 hours.
Engineering and scientific principles governing bioprocessing of biomass for production of ethanol and other fermentation products. Process unit operations; conventional and alternative feed stock materials; recovery of value-added coproducts and other variables involved in producing fuel ethanol; process simulation; economic analysis.
4 undergraduate hours. 4 graduate hours. Prerequisite: ME 200 or ChBE 321. Restricted to students with junior or senior class standing.
